CBS GOT JACK'D

FIRST OF ITS KIND JACK-FM CBS RADIO SHOW PRODUCED EXCLUSIVELY FOR THE WEB WITH CBS PRIMETIME STARS DEBUTS MONDAY, SEPTEMBER 18

For the first time ever, the CBS Marketing Group and CBS RADIO present a one-week online JACK-FM radio show to promote the CBS Television Network's fall line-up. The exclusive limited-edition radio-cast, CBS GOT JACK'D, which can be accessed on the web the week of September 18 at www.cbsgotjackd.com, is produced by CBS RADIO and features some of the biggest and brightest stars on the Network.

CBS primetime stars Jon Cryer, George Eads, Franky G, Alyson Hannigan, Jennifer Love Hewitt, Lauren Holly, Phil Keoghan, Ray Liotta, Camryn Manheim, Kathryn Morris, Jeff Probst, Gary Sinise, James Woods and more, share their favorite songs of all time and give listeners the inside track on this season's new and returning CBS series. The website will also include unique JACK-FM animation that will appear throughout the two-hour special. JACK-FM stations nationwide will promote CBS GOT JACK'D with soundbites from the online show and provide giveaways to listeners from hit CBS series.

CBS GOT JACK'D will feature cast members from all four new CBS fall series: SHARK, SMITH, JERICHO and THE CLASS, as well as returning series CSI: CRIME SCENE INVESTIGATION, CSI: NY, COLD CASE, NCIS, THE UNIT, TWO AND A HALF MEN, GHOST WHISPERER, HOW I MET YOUR MOTHER, SURVIVOR, THE AMAZING RACE and daytime game show, THE PRICE IS RIGHT.

Listeners can log online at any time during premiere week to hear CBS stars like James Woods riff about the Rolling Stones; Jeri Ryan introduce one of her favorite songs of all time, "I Want You to Want Me" by Cheap Trick; Alyson Hannigan's secret confession that she was a huge Michael Jackson fan back in the 80's; Bob Barker, who shares personal stories about Frank Sinatra and Sammy Davis Jr.; and Jon Cryer and Angus T. Jones, who offer their eclectic playlists, which include heavy metal and alternative bands.

Featuring a random mix of more than 1200 hit songs from the past five decades, JACK-FM is a highly music intensive format boasting the most expansive playlist heard on the radio today. Highlights of the format also include limited interruption and less repetition.

About CBS RADIO

CBS RADIO is one of the largest major-market operators in the United States with stations covering news, alternative rock, country, FM talk, classic rock, oldies, JACK and urban formats, among others. A division of CBS Corporation, CBS RADIO operates 179 radio stations, the majority of which are in the nation's top 50 markets. CBS RADIO also has made aggressive moves to converge new and traditional media through creative programming and advanced delivery methods, including online streaming, HD Radio and podcasting. In May 2005, CBS RADIO launched the world's first podcast programmed radio station, KYOURADIO, and also has made three of its top sports radio stations available to subscribers of mSpot's All-Sports mobile radio service.
